Q2 2024 Surge in Tower Defense Games on Unified Platforms

As the second quarter of 2024 comes to a close, Sensor Tower has gathered data on the top 5 tower defense games, revealing interesting trends in downloads, revenue, and weekly active users. Here's a snapshot of how these games have fared across unified platforms.

Primal Conquest: Dino Era made its debut in April and saw a sharp increase in downloads, peaking at 2.9M in the third week of April. Weekly active users followed a similar upward trend, hitting a high of nearly 2M by the end of April. Revenue started to be recorded in mid-April, reaching up to $1.8K by the end of May.

For Bloons TD 6 NETFLIX, downloads remained steady with an average of around 800K per week, while weekly active users saw a slight decline from 8.1M at the start of April to 7.3M by the end of June. The game's revenue experienced fluctuations with a peak of $46 in late April.

Rush Royale: Tower Defense TD showed consistent performance in revenue, with a notable spike to $11.8K in mid-April. Downloads hovered around the 500K to 600K range weekly, while weekly active users remained strong, starting at 8.8M and ending the quarter at 7.9M.

Plants vs. Zombies™ maintained modest revenue figures, averaging around $30 to $50 weekly. Downloads saw a peak of 550K in late June, and weekly active users stayed above the 2.5M mark throughout the quarter.

Lastly, BangBang Survivor launched in early May and quickly ramped up to $1.7K in revenue by early June. Downloads saw a starting surge at 1.5M but gradually decreased to 278K by the end of June. Weekly active users experienced an initial rise, reaching 1.8M in the third week of May.
